Question label:
Financial numeracy 5 years
Question text:
Imagine a savings account with a current balance of £100. The interest rate is fixed at 1% per year.
After 5 years, how much money will be in the account if no money is withdrawn?

| Value label | Value | Absolute frequency | Relative frequency |
|---|---|---|---|
| missing | -9 | 2 | 0.07% |
| inapplicable | -8 | 1978 | 69.48% |
| proxy | -7 | 22 | 0.77% |
| refusal | -2 | 20 | 0.7% |
| don't know | -1 | 43 | 1.51% |
| £101 or less | 1 | 41 | 1.44% |
| More than £101, but no more than £106 | 2 | 549 | 19.28% |
| More than £106, but no more than £111 | 3 | 161 | 5.66% |
| More than £111 | 4 | 31 | 1.09% |
| Total | 2847 | 100.0% |
